Is 245 361 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 245 361 is about 495.339.

Thus, the square root of 245 361 is not an integer, and therefore 245 361 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 245 361?

The square of a number (here 245 361) is the result of the product of this number (245 361) by itself (i.e., 245 361 × 245 361); the square of 245 361 is sometimes called "raising 245 361 to the power 2", or "245 361 squared".

The square of 245 361 is 60 202 020 321 because 245 361 × 245 361 = 245 3612 = 60 202 020 321.

As a consequence, 245 361 is the square root of 60 202 020 321.
